At present, the most commonly used cold source and heat source of air conditioner in our country are based on electric power and fossil energy (coal, oil, gas), especially, coal consists the most part of the energy, the energy structure is unreasonable, the energy utilization ratio is low, and the environment is seriously polluted. From the viewpoint of sustainable development, while choosing the cold source and heat source of air conditioner, we should consider from respects such as energy-efficiency, environmental protection, etc. The ground-coupled heat pump, regarded as a green air conditioner that takes energy-conservation and environmental protection as characteristics in the 21st century, has broad development prospects in our country.This paper sets up the model of buried heat exchanger for ground-coupled heat pump system, programs the solving procedure of heat transfer content per meter pipe, and analyzes the influence on heat transfer content per meter pipe of designed outlet temperature of the circling liquid in buried heat exchangers, buried distance, drilling depth and soil thermophysical parameters, and then provides reference for the chosing of parameters during the designing of the ground-coupled heat pump systems.Beginning with the study of the climates of three areas-Shanghai, Guangzhou, Tianjin, this paper figures out dynamic load during the whole year with modified BIN method, according to the climate characteristics of every city, chooses four kinds of commonly used cold source and heat source systems and carries on comparative analysis with ground-coupled heat pump system. Through every scheme's part-load curve of unit selected, calculates their energy consumption through out the year, then converts into the primary energy consumption and carries on comparation, meanwhile, analyzes the influences on environment through calculation. The initial cost and operating expenses of every project is obtained, and economic evaluation of every project is carried out with annual cost approach.The author selects drilling expense, fuel price, life cycle and interest rate as the sensitive factors, and carries on sensitiveness analysis to annual cost of every...
